Street Vendors Are Workers – They Should Have Workers’ Rights

From a hot dog vendor in the United States to a girl selling vegetables in the Democratic Republic of Congo to a woman running a tea stall in Bangladesh, street vendors are an integral part of the urban fabric around the world.They boost local economies, supplying an array of affordable goods and services.
